What is CMX Gold & Silver Common Stock?

CMX Gold & Silver CXXMF 24 Common Stock is $4.55 Mil as of Dec. 2025. GuruFocus rates CXXMF with a GF Score™ of 24/100. The stock has 2 warning signs investors should review.

CMX Gold & Silver's quarterly common stock declined from Jun. 2025 ($4.20 Mil) to Sep. 2025 ($4.15 Mil) but then increased from Sep. 2025 ($4.15 Mil) to Dec. 2025 ($4.55 Mil).

CMX Gold & Silver's annual common stock declined from Dec. 2023 ($4.19 Mil) to Dec. 2024 ($4.03 Mil) but then increased from Dec. 2024 ($4.03 Mil) to Dec. 2025 ($4.55 Mil).

CMX Gold & Silver Common Stock Calculation

Common stock is listed on the Balance Sheet at the par value of the total shares outstanding of a company.

The par value of common stocks is meaningless. It is usually set at an absurdly low number.

CMX Gold & Silver Business Description

Other Exchanges 6GS:GermanyCXC:Canada
Address 31 Stranraer Place SW, Calgary, AB, CAN, T3H 1H5
CMX Gold & Silver Corp is a junior mining company with a silver-lead-zinc property in the United States of America. The company's focus is on the development of its wholly-owned Clayton Silver Property located in Idaho, U.S.A., with the primary focus being to determine the feasibility of reactivating the mine. Geographically, it operates in Canada and the United States.
